
It’s just a drop in the bucket!
I'm sure we've all heard that expression. Its purpose is to trivialize something and it's often used to discourage small attempts to make a positive change, suggesting that such efforts are pointless.
And they’re right. It is but a drop in the bucket.
However, let me ask you this question.
What was in that bucket before you put your drop in?
Water?
Guess what! The water in that bucket is made up of drops. That’s how you fill that bucket, one drop at a time.
So yes, it is just a drop in the bucket. However, the only way we’ll fill that bucket is if we each put our drops in it.
My books … and this website … are simply my drops in the bucket.
On their own, they probably won’t make much difference. However, as part of a greater whole, maybe, just maybe, they can do their part.
It’s just a drop in the bucket, but so are all the other drops!
